North American steel plate manufacturer Leeco Steel has announced that its Monterrey distribution centre in Mexico has enjoyed 11 years accident-free as of 1 April 2023.

According to the company, the safety milestone was achieved thanks to the team's attention to detail and its people-focused approach and accountability.

“We have morning check-ins to see how people are feeling. This helps us gauge whether someone needs to be moved to a job function that does not handle heavy equipment,” said Mario Farias, warehouse supervisor at Leeco’s Mexico facility. “We find that efforts such as these go a long way in keeping our team safe. We are proud of our safety record and look forward to extending it by continuing to make safety improvements.”

Leeco is currently over five years accident-free at eight of its 11 North American distribution centres and over seven years accident-free at five of its distribution centres. The company’s Portage, IN distribution centre is also over 10 years accident-free.
